About the area
Columbia Falls, Montana, is a gateway to natural splendor and outdoor adventure, making it an ideal destination for nature enthusiasts and those seeking a tranquil escape. Nestled in the Flathead Valley, this charming town is just a stone's throw away from the majestic Glacier National Park, often referred to as the "Crown of the Continent." The park's rugged peaks, alpine meadows, and crystal-clear lakes provide a stunning backdrop for hiking, wildlife viewing, and photography.
For those who revel in water-based activities, the nearby Flathead River offers opportunities for whitewater rafting, fishing, and leisurely floats. The river's clean waters are home to a variety of fish species, making it a paradise for anglers. In the winter, the region transforms into a snowy wonderland, with Whitefish Mountain Resort close by for skiing and snowboarding enthusiasts.
Columbia Falls itself exudes a welcoming small-town atmosphere, with local shops, cozy cafes, and community events that showcase the warmth of its residents. The town's weekly summer market is a highlight, featuring local artisans, fresh produce, and live music, encapsulating the spirit of Montana's friendly community life.
For those interested in history and culture, the Big Sky Waterpark offers a fun family outing with its slides and pools, while the Montana Vortex and House of Mystery provide a quirky and mind-bending experience. The Conrad Mansion Museum in nearby Kalispell gives visitors a glimpse into the luxurious early 20th-century lifestyle of the valley's founders.
Columbia Falls is also a convenient base for exploring the wider Flathead Valley, with its numerous lakes, including the expansive Flathead Lake, the largest natural freshwater lake west of the Mississippi. The lake's clear waters are perfect for boating, swimming, and picnicking along its shores.
With its combination of outdoor adventure, scenic beauty, and a welcoming community, Columbia Falls offers a slice of Montana that is both exhilarating and peaceful. It's a place where the grandeur of the natural world is always within reach, and the pace of life encourages visitors to slow down and savor every moment.
